Enhancing focus in preschool is crucial for the holistic development of young children and to cultivate essential skills that will benefit them throughout their educational journey. During the preschool years, children's brains undergo significant development, making it a prime time to cultivate attention and concentration. Improved focus enhances children's ability to engage in activities, leading to better learning outcomes and motivation.

Moreover, preschool serves as an essential foundation for social skills and emotional regulation. When children learn to concentrate, they can effectively participate in group activities, share experiences, and develop empathy toward their peers. Focus fosters problem-solving skills and critical thinking, providing an essential toolkit as they progress through their educational experiences.

Educators and parents play a pivotal role in nurturing this focus. Through structured play, routines, and activities designed to capture children’s attention, they can create an environment where children feel encouraged and supported. This not only boosts academic performance but also improves children's self-esteem and sense of achievement.

Investing in enhancing focus not only aids immediate learning but also prepares them for future challenges, promoting lifelong skills. Ultimately, a child's ability to focus can greatly influence their overall development, making it a priority for both parents and educators alike.
